Nellie, we stayed at High meadow Farm CL, it is in a lovely area, very quiet and has footpath to Coleford opposite the entrance and a bridleway to Newland just down the road..
The site however was a little disappointing, it could however be really lovely with a little tlc. Parts of the site were sloping, but with careful pitching it was ok.The grass was very long which wasn't too much of a problem as the weather was good, CDP was a bit primative, straight into a septic tank. On leaving took the general rubbish to the bin which was crawling with maggots!
The owners however were really lovely and lots of area info in the shed. It was a shame as it was in an good location. Not sure if I would recommend or not.
